The SFJazz Center's Joe Henderson Lab is one of those hidden gems where the spirit of jazz really comes alive. Walking into the space feels like stepping back into a vintage jazz club, with warm wood paneling that immediately sets a cozy yet vibrant mood. It’s more than just a concert hall; the venue champions jazz as a living art form, encouraging fresh, creative expressions that keep the genre evolving. The layout is intimate, making every show feel personal, and the community room is a real highlight, hosting everything from educational workshops to regional talent showcases. Plus, they organize the annual SFJazz Poetry Festival, which ties jazz and literary arts together in a way that just clicks.
